Just like the classically cute candy corn, this cake consists of three colorful layers of yellow, orange, and white. To add to the extravagance of this cake, there’s alayer of densely richcheesecake in the middle. Instead of making a boring ‘ol three-layer cake, I replaced one of those layers with cheesecake. Since this cake has three different components–cheesecake, frosting, and cake–I decided to give myself a break by using a box cake mixfor the orange and yellow layers. Feel free, however, to use a from-scratch recipe if you can’t stand the ease and convenience ofbox cake mixes.

Besides, box cake mixes taste just as amazing in my opinion (Julia Child is rolling in her grave), and they’re so much easier.For this cake, I useda yellow cake mix, divided it in half, then tinted one half orange with some food coloring. I didn’t add any food coloring to the yellow layer since it was a “yellow” cake, however,if you want your layer to bake upyellower,add a little yellow food coloring.

Candy Corn Cheesecake Cake - A baJillian Recipes (5)

For the frosting, I went with a simple vanilla buttercream. To assure a smoother finish, I first added a crumb coat to the cake which is basically a thin layer of frosting. Once that layer hardened up, Icreated the subtle hombre look by adding globs of yellow frosting to the bottom third, followed by globs of orange frosting to the middle third, andfinally, white to the top third. Then, with an offset spatula, I smoothed the frosting evenly around the cake, trying not to mix the colors too much. A little mixing between colorsdoesn’t hurt though!

Course Dessert

Cuisine American

Servings 12 Servings

Ingredients

Cheesecake:

  • 16 ounces cream cheese softened
  • ¾ cup granulated sugar
  • 2 Tablespoons cornstarch
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la
  • ½ teaspoon lemon juice
  • teaspoon salt
  • 2 eggs

Cake:

  • 1 box Yellow cake mix plus the ingredients called for on the box
  • Orange food coloring (or red + yellow)

Vanilla Buttercream:

  • 1 ½ cup unsalted butter
  • teaspoon salt
  • 4 ¾ cup powdered sugar
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la
  • teaspoon almond extract
  • ½ cup heavy cream
  • Gel Food Coloring: Orange and Yellow

Instructions

Make the Cheesecake:

  • Preheat the oven to 325ºF. Line an 8-inch springform pan with parchment paper. Spray with nonstick cooking spray.

  • In the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with the paddle attachment, beat cream cheese on high until creamy, about 1-2 minutes. Add the sugar and continue beating for another 1-2 minutes. Scrape down the sides of the bowl, add the cornstarch, vanilla, lemon juice, and salt, and beat until incorporated, 1-3 minutes. Beat in the eggs until combined. Try not to overmix.

  • Pour filling intopan, smoothing out the top. Bake cheesecake for 35-40 minutes, or until center appears nearly set when shaken.Transfer the cheesecake to a wire rack and run a knife around the edges. Allow to cool for at least 2 hours before covering cheesecake and chilling in the freezerforabout 30 minutes.

Make the Cake:

  • Prepare cake mix according to package instructions. Divide batter into two separate bowls. Tint onehalf of the batter withthe orange food coloring. Pour each batter into separate parchment-lined 8-inch baking pans. Bake according to package instructions.Cool cakes completely.

Make the Buttercream:

  • In the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with the paddle attachment, beat the butter and salt together on high until fluffy and pale in color, about 4-5 minutes. Decrease speed to low and slowly add the powdered sugar. Add the vanilla extract, almond extract, and heavy cream andbeat until combined. Increase speed to medium-high and beat until light and fluffy, about 4 minutes.

To Assemble:

  • Place orangecake layer on a pedestal or plate. Spread on a thin layer of buttercream, then place the cheesecake layer on top. Addanother thin layer of buttercream on the cheesecake, then place the yellowcake layer on top. Frost the entire cake to seal in the crumbs; chill for at least 30 minutes.

  • Divide remaining buttercream into three separate bowls. Tint one bowl orange, and another bowl yellow.Remove cake from the fridge. With an offset spatula, add globs of yellow frosting to the bottom third, followed by globs of orange frosting to the middle third, andfinally, white to the top third. Then, smooththe frosting evenly around the cake, trying not to mix the colors too much.

  • Fill a pastry bag fitted with a round tip with the remainingyellowfrosting and pipe some buttercream dollops around the border. Repeat with the orange buttercream, topping each yellow dollopwith an orange dollop. Repeat step with the white buttercream.

  • Cake will keep covered in the refrigeratorfor up to 5 days.
